3. In your own opinion why is it importance of having a uniform in the kitchen?


In my own opinion, it is important to have a kitchen uniform to protect you from potential
hazards, such as direct heat from the open flames on your stove or hot splashes from
gastronome trays of oil removed from the oven. And also ensures food safety and cleanliness
when you are starting to cook and this will help to ensure that any contaminants carried on
normal clothing, such as pet hairs or dirt, do not contaminate the food that you are making.
